titleOfInvention Frame-shaped mems piezoresistive resonator
abstract A novel Si MEMS piezoresistive resonator is described. The resonator has a shape of a frame, such as a ring or a polygon frame, which has two or more anchors. Electrodes located at the outer or inner rim of the resonant structure are used to excite the structure electrostatically into resonance with a desired mode shape. One or plurality of locally doped regions on the structure is used for piezoresistive readout of the signal. In the most preferred embodiments, the structure is a ring, which has four anchors, two electrodes and four piezoresistive regions at different segments of the structure. The piezoresistive regions are alternatively located at the outer rim and inner rim of the structure in such a way that the piezoresistive signals of the same sign from different regions can be collected. Advantages of this device are large readout signal, large electrode area, robustness, suppressed out-of-plane vibration and larger usable linear range.
